[docs]def graph_decode(z, edge_index):
"""
Compute edge-wise similarity scores using dot product of node embeddings.
Parameters
----------
z : torch.Tensor
Node embeddings of shape [num_nodes, embedding_dim].
edge_index : torch.Tensor
Edge index tensor with shape [2, num_edges].
Returns
-------
torch.Tensor
Edge probabilities computed via sigmoid(dot(z_i, z_j)).
"""
logit = (z[edge_index[0]] * z[edge_index[1]]).sum(dim=1)
return torch.sigmoid(logit)
[docs]def graph_recon_crit(
z,
pos_edge_index,
num_neg
):
"""
BCE-style reconstruction loss on sampled positive/negative edges.
Parameters
----------
z : torch.Tensor
Node embeddings of shape ``[N, D]``.
pos_edge_index : torch.Tensor
Positive edges as index tensor of shape ``[2, E_pos]``.
num_neg : int or None
Number of negative edges to sample. If ``None``, defaults to ``E_pos``.
Returns
-------
torch.Tensor
Scalar loss value averaged over positives and negatives.
"""
if pos_edge_index is None or pos_edge_index.numel() == 0:
return torch.zeros((), device=z.device, dtype=z.dtype)
E_pos = pos_edge_index.size(1)
num_neg = E_pos if num_neg is None else max(1, int(num_neg))
neg_edge_index = negative_sampling(
edge_index=pos_edge_index,
num_nodes=z.size(0),
num_neg_samples=num_neg
).to(z.device)
pos_prob = graph_decode(z, pos_edge_index)
neg_prob = graph_decode(z, neg_edge_index)
pos_loss = -torch.log(pos_prob + 1e-20)
neg_loss = -torch.log(1.0 - neg_prob + 1e-20)
return pos_loss.mean() + neg_loss.mean()
